    Keep in mind that MOVING Multisite is harder than moving singlesite.

    What you want to do IS possible, but it’s complicated, and if just turning on Multisite is too much for you, I would consider hiring someone.

    If you only want two sites, then multisite does not help you very much. It is easier to install WordPress separately on each site.

    If you really do need to use multisite, and if you plan to publish your sites using WebMatrix, then you need to be sure that WebMatrix supports multisite. You might run into trouble if you create your multisite network on localhost and then discover that WebMatrix cannot publish it on the Internet.

    I want to create a second site giving link from main blog to the second.

    You can place a link in your menu to any site you want – it does not need to be multisite or a second install or it could even be wordpress.org.

    THe part of linking the two together is just… making a link in HTML. Multisite does not do that part for you.
